Summary of the invention
The object of the present invention is to provide a kind of ferro-aluminum composition metal inhibiter that prevents the ferroaluminium corrosion and preparation method thereof.
The technical solution that realizes the object of the invention is:
A kind of ferro-aluminum composition metal inhibiter comprises the following composition that is calculated in mass percent: trolamine 8~10%, borax 3~6%, HEDP1~2%, trisodium citrate 6~8%, glucose 2~4%, urotropine 3~5%, remaining content are water.
A kind of preparation method of ferro-aluminum composition metal inhibiter, with thanomin, borax, HEDP, trisodium citrate, glucose, urotropine and water mix, add low-grade fever, be the fully dissolvings in water of these materials, and stir; Wherein the mass percent of trolamine is 8~10%, the mass percent of borax is 3~6%, the mass percent of HEDP is 1~2%, the mass percent of trisodium citrate is 6~8%, the mass percent of glucose is 2~4%, the mass percent of urotropine is 3~5%.

Trolamine, trisodium citrate, glucose and urotropine belong to absorption membranous type inhibiter, and the protection metal is not corroded by medium thereby its active group can be adsorbed in the metallic surface; HEDP belongs to precipitation membranous type inhibiter, and it generates inner complex formation precipitation membrane with calcium ions and magnesium ions reaction in the water and is attached to the metallic surface; Borax belongs to the type oxide film inhibiter, thereby can generate passive film with the water oxygen ionic reaction metal is played protective effect.Above several materials are mixed by a certain percentage composite, be ferro-aluminum composition metal inhibiter of the present invention, this compound corrosion inhibitor can play good corrosion inhibition to the ferro-aluminum composition metal.
Embodiment 1: a kind of ferro-aluminum composition metal inhibiter, comprise that remaining content is water take glucose as 3% of trisodium citrate as 8% of HEDP as 1.5% of borax as 5% of the trolamine of mass percent as 8%, mass percent, mass percent, mass percent, mass percent, the mass percent urotropine as 3%; These materials are mixed in water, be heated to 55 ℃, be 10 minutes heat-up time, makes the fully dissolving in water of these materials, and stir, and just obtained ferro-aluminum composition metal inhibiter of the present invention.
The outside workpiece of automobile engine cylinder-body belongs to aluminium alloy, and iron and steel is inlayed in inside.Ferro-aluminum composition metal inhibiter of the present invention is used for the curing process of automobile engine cylinder-body after infiltration, can play good protective effect to automobile engine cylinder-body, so that it is not corroded in 90 ℃ of high-temperature water, can preserve for some time does not simultaneously corrode.Automobile engine cylinder-body is used composite corrosion inhibitor of the present invention when solidifying, behind the 15min, automobile engine cylinder-body is not any change in 94 ℃ of water of high temperature, deposit simultaneously 15 days after, iron non-corrosive, aluminium alloy nondiscoloration after 3 months.
The static corrosion experiment, aluminium and iron test piece are all placed in 94 ℃ of water, add ferro-aluminum composition metal inhibiter of the present invention, take out test piece behind the 15min, survey its year erosion rate and corrosion inhibition rate after 3 months are placed in the aluminium test piece, and the iron test piece is placed after 15 days and surveyed its erosion rate and corrosion inhibition rate.The results are shown in following table.

By above static corrosion experiment as can be known, in the ferro-aluminum compound slow corrosion agent prescription, the trolamine mass percent is 10%, the borax mass percent is 6%, the HEDP mass percent is 2%, the trisodium citrate mass percent is 6%, glucose 2%, urotropine 5%, the corrosion inhibition rate of ferro-aluminum test piece is the highest, can arrive more than 99.5%, the corrosion mitigating effect of the ferro-aluminum composite corrosion inhibitor of this prescription is best.
